I was checking out ZipScanners & noticed that they sell the NXDN & DMR for $89 installed.
I opened up chat & asked them what the difference between their key for $89 & Uniden's for $50 is.
Here's a paste of the chat transcript:
You — What is the difference in the NXDN upgrade that you offer for 89.99 & the one directly from Uniden at 50.00?
Police Scanner Expert --Hey there. Want me to look up what police scanner is required in your area? Shoot me your zip code & I'll take a peek. Thanks!
Jessie joined the chat
Jessie -- its totally the same... Its just that Our NXDN will be forever, with them... you need to renew it after 1 year
You — So the key I purchased from them in March of 2018 will expire?
Jessie -- yes
You —Will the DMR key expire also?
Jessie -- yes
You — Ok - I'll renew them when it quits working - What is your price on renewing DMR key on 436 & 536 & NXDN Key on 536?
Jessie -- here, its $89- one time payment - no expiration

Well that's the first I've heard of Keys expiring - I think it's total hogwash & ZipScanners is trying to pull a fast one!
I am well aware of their reputation - Just thought I'd mess with 'em!
Uniden should really take notice of this since they are a "dealer"
That is unless "Uncle Jesse" IS telling the truth??????

Our rep was confused and misspoke. The keys do not expire.

I have sent this thread and FB thread (think this is now deleted) to rep to ensure this does not happen again. Thanks for bringing to my attention. Email me directly at luke@zipscanners.com if you'd like to discuss or if there is anything we can do. Sorry about the confusion on our part. Thanks.
